Determine if the relation y = 4 - 1 is a function by first graphing the relation, then applying the
vertical line test. Enter 1 if the relation is a function. Enter 2 if the relation is not a function. (1 point)
The relation is given by y = 4 - 1. By simplifying, we have y = 3.
To graph the relation, we plot points where y = 3. It means that for every x-value we choose, the corresponding y-value will always be 3.
So the graph is a horizontal line passing through y = 3.
Now, we can apply the vertical line test. The vertical line test states that if any vertical line intersects the graph in more than one point, then the graph does not represent a function.
For this graph, if we draw any vertical line, it will only intersect the graph at one point, as the graph is a straight horizontal line.
Therefore, the relation y = 3 is a function.
The answer is 1.
